E-paper Display Technology Principles:
E-paper Display (EPD) technology, also known as electronic ink display technology, relies on microcapsule technology. The basic structure of an EPD includes millions of tiny capsules, each containing two types of electrophoretic particles: negatively charged white particles and positively charged black particles, suspended in a transparent fluid.
- Electrophoresis: When an electric field is applied, the corresponding black or white particles move to the top of the microcapsule, making the area appear black or white to the user. This is achieved by utilizing the charged particles and the principle of attraction under an electric field.
- Bistable Technology: By supplying electrodes with positive and negative electric fields, the charged black and white particles move and align according to the attraction principle of different charges. After removing the electric field, the particle arrangement remains unchanged, keeping the image constant. When updating the image, a different electric field is applied to the electrodes, causing the particles to move again, resulting in a screen refresh. The new electric field pattern rearranges the black and white particles, updating the display.

Product Applications:
EPD technology has widespread applications in various fields. WINSTAR EPD is mainly used in the following areas:
- Eye Protection Devices: Such as e-readers and laptop screens, offering a paper-like reading experience that reduces eye fatigue from prolonged viewing.
- Energy-Saving Devices: Such as smartwatches and fitness trackers, leveraging low power consumption to extend battery life, suitable for long-running devices.
- Outdoor Devices: Electronic labels, electronic billboards, etc., suitable for high-brightness environments to ensure visibility under strong light.
